When he was just seven years old, a young boy bravely testified in court that his mother had drowned his sister in their backyard pool. At the time, many believed the drowning was an accident, but his words told a far darker story.
The boy, now 24, revealed that his mother intentionally harmed his sister, a tragic event that forever changed his life. His testimony led to the conviction of his mother for first-degree murder and aggravated child abuse. She was sentenced to life in prison without the possibility of parole.
For years, the boy lived with the trauma of witnessing such a horrific event and the loss of his sister. Recently, after 17 years of silence, he chose to speak out publicly for the first time. He stood firm, saying, “I just told them exactly what I saw, word for word.”
Now living with an adoptive family, he describes his life as much happier and more stable. Though legally prevented from contacting his mother, he focuses on healing and hopes his story raises awareness about the impact of childhood trauma and the courage it takes to speak the truth.
